In this section you can find all results from our Canadian athletes at the Summer and Winter Deaflympics, Pan American Games and World Championships since 1959. To March 31st, 2020 no less than 597 Canadian athletes participated in one of the 26 sports in 61 events sanctioned by the International Committee of Sports for the Deaf.
